A suspect has been formally charged with a crime (either through prosecutor information or grand jury indictment). The suspect h

as been assigned defense counsel. While in police custody, the suspect contacts police detectives requesting a meeting to discuss the charges and evidence. The police: ____________.
Social Studies
1 answer:
QveST [7]4 years ago
6 0

Answer:

The police must must contact the suspect's attorney.

Explanation:

In the mentioned case, the suspect cannot have directly meeting with the detectives of the police, rather these requirements are to be met through the attorney of the suspect.

When a stimulus is removed from a person or animal, resulting in a decrease in the probability of response, it is known as _____
LUCKY_DIMON [66]

Answer:

Negative punishment.

Explanation:

As the exercise briefly describes, when a stimulus is removed from a person or animal, resulting in a decrease in the probability of response, it is known as negative punishment. In behavioral terms, positive means adding whereas negative means taking. The goal of punishment is to decrease a determined behavior. Therefore, if a person takes something good for example a dog's bone, when the dog behaves poorly, it will likely decrease this response. And, if the dog behaves well, and you give him the bone, this will make him tend to act like that.

A key issue in the post-Civil War era, the 14th Amendment guarantees which of the selections below under the laws for all citize
Sidana [21]

<u>Answer: </u>

The 14th Amendment guarantees Equal protection .

<u>Explanation: </u>

The 14th Amendment addresses various matters regarding the citizenship and rights of the citizens. This amendment guaranteed that all individuals would be treated the same way without any sort of discrimination, and this shall be done regardless of the circumstances.

This ensures the protection of civil rights and allows a government to rule impartially without making any distinctions based on matters of irrelevance. When an individual feels that either the federal or the state government has violated this clause, he /she can file a lawsuit against the government for relief.
